Transaction 72c6806205af1c732ae71b104296316476275ad6942df9e60a4024b141691b4d
2 Input
2 Outputs
- 72c6806205af1c732ae71b104296316476275ad6942df9e60a4024b141691b4d:0
- 72c6806205af1c732ae71b104296316476275ad6942df9e60a4024b141691b4d:1
value 407975
address 1Q8WBvakyyFLmcyzSiL4gsTnG2Q7sxxqWZ
value 16923571
address 3CxYqHcjrg152aef3gtqewbRcBN2GpYj7A